Arranged for a complimentary wheelchair through Holland America for embarkation ONLY at Port Everglades.

 

The letter from Holland didn't make the process clear. For those with experience, where do I need to go or who do I need to look for when we get out of the taxi? I'm sure it'll be marked, but I like to be able to answer my party's questions beforehand. :)

Our TA makes the arrangements through HAL for me to have a wheelchair for embarkation and disembarkation days.

The rules vary at different terminals in Ft Lauderdale. Most of the time I go to the door and tell them that arrangements were made for me to have wheelchair assistance. Sometimes they come right away with one -- other times I have had to wait. Once I get the wheelchair, I am wheeled up to the check-in counter.

After check-in I am wheeled to an area where people who need assistance are placed. Sometimes I get to stay in the wheelchair, other times I have to sit in a chair to wait for embarkation to be begin. Sometimes we are given a number and sometimes we are not given a number.

When embarkation begins, staff from the ship come and wheel us onto the ship. Some times I am first. One time there was a new employee working in the terminal and she called rows instead of taking care of the wheelchairs -- total chaos.
